Different Louver Models
Before beginning a louver installation, it’s important to determine which type of louvers best fits your property’s needs. Different louver systems are designed for different applications and levels of performance. For example, privacy louvers are built to limit visibility and create a more secure perimeter around commercial properties. Other louvers are specifically engineered to protect outdoor equipment, such as generators and HVAC systems, by promoting proper airflow while helping keep out debris and external elements. Choosing the right commercial louvers from the start ensures better functionality, security, and long-term performance for your property.
Taking Care of Your Property’s Louvers
One of the major advantages of commercial louvers is that they require very little maintenance. Built for durability and long-term performance, louvers are designed to withstand daily exposure to weather and outdoor conditions. Even so, routine inspections are important to ensure they remain in proper working condition over time. Occasional cleaning is also recommended to remove dirt, debris, and buildup that can accumulate on the surface. In most cases, cleaning every few months is sufficient, although properties exposed to harsher weather conditions may require more frequent maintenance to keep their louvers looking and performing their best.
Materials for a Commercial Louver Set
Once you’ve selected the right type of louvers for your property, the next step is choosing the best material. While several material options are available, aluminum remains one of the top choices for commercial louvers due to its durability, versatility, and low maintenance requirements. Aluminum louvers can be customized to fit a wide range of layouts and property types, making them suitable for nearly any environment or terrain. In addition to their long-lasting performance, aluminum louvers are also recyclable and environmentally friendly, making them a smart and sustainable investment for commercial properties.
